Analysis: Why China Is Rewriting Its Stock Market Refinancing Rules

China’s securities regulator has proposed a major overhaul of the refinancing system, with draft rules that target a type of private placement arbitrage that has allowed select investors to buy shares at steep discounts while minority shareholders bear the dilution.

The move comes amid a sharp rebound in fundraising. After collapsing to 223 billion yuan ($31.3 billion) in 2024, the Chinese mainland stock market’s refinancing more than quadrupled to 951 billion yuan last year. Citic Securities Co. Ltd. expects the figure to exceed 1 trillion yuan this year.
